Salut
je cherche à tester l’existence d'un fichier ou dossier afin de lancer une procédure de supression
sauf que mon test ne marche pas sachant que je test d'abord si le fichier est présent sur le disque dur puis sur le disque commun et si ce n'est pas le cas je supprime tous. J'ai essayer avec fichierExiste mais ca ne fonctionne pas, avec dir ca fonctionnait sur le disque dur mais pas sur le commun ou ma boucle if buggait.
bon j'ai un peu avancé
voici mon code pour retrouver le fichier non caché sur le disque C
reste pour le P commun ou le code fonctionne mais une fois le dossier caché ca ne marche plus quelle est la modification a effectuer?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 'test fichier pour le C Sub Testeee() MsgBox FichierExiste("C:\toto.txt") End Sub Function FichierExiste(NomFichier As String) As Boolean FichierExiste = Dir(NomFichier, vbDirectory) <> "" End Function
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 'test Dossier pour le P Sub Testee() MsgBox DossierExiste("P:\dossiertoto") End Sub Function DossierExiste(NomDossier As String) As Boolean DossierExiste = Dir(NomDossier, vbDirectory) <> "" End Function
Partager